Welcome to the Trading Data Warehouse & BI team, where you will work in an fast-paced, agile environment, with stakeholders representing Scandinavia’s largest trading floor. We are supporting a wide range of business processes in Nordea’s Trading business domain.

 

About this opportunity

 

As the Lead Data Architect you’ll play an important role in our transition to cloud. You are a data veteran, and knowledgeable on the latest trends in near real time data warehousing in the cloud.

 

What you’ll be doing:

  • Defining needs around maintainability, testability, performance, security, quality and usability for our future data platform.
  • Designing the data architecture for greater scalability, data quality automation and self-service reporting.
  • Supporting with best practice database design, driving consistent implementation of the data models and a good level of documentation.
  • Evaluating new developments and evolving business requirements and recommend appropriate enhancements to current systems by analyzing business processes, systems and industry standard.
  • Being the technical expert and mentor other team members on existing and future tech stacks (DataStage, Oracle, Kafka, Snowflake, AWS, PowerBI, SSAS).

 

You’ll join a young team of enthusiastic data professionals across Scandinavia, Poland and India. This particular role is based in Copenhagen.

Your experience and background:

  • Degree in computer science and engineering, mathematical modelling or similar.
  • Minimum 10 years of professional experience as Data/BI Architect, BI Specialist, Data Engineer (ideally a combination).
  • Experience in large scale production environments and implementation of modern data architectures.
  • Proven track record in migrating on premise data warehouse environments into the cloud.
  • Good understanding of data modelling principles, data classification and matching the focus on implementation details.
